4,66,251 get COVID-19 vaccines in Rangpur division

RANGPUR, March 20, 2021 (BSS) – The number of COVID-19 vaccine recipients
rose to 4,66,251 as 8,566 people were inoculated today in Rangpur division.

“Among the vaccine receivers today, 4,662 were male and 3,904 female,”
Rangpur Divisional Director (Health) Dr. Md. Ahad Ali told BSS.

Of the total vaccine receivers in the division, 2,86,268 are male and
1,79,983 female.

“All vaccine recipients are leading normal life without remarkable side
effects,” Dr Ali said.

The district-wise break-up of vaccine recipients stands at 1,15,832 in
Rangpur, 35,428 in Panchagarh, 63,880 in Nilphamari, 31,137 in Lalmonirhat,
38,720 in Kurigram, 43,326 in Thakurgaon, 90,532 in Dinajpur and 47,396 in
Gaibandha of the division.

Chief of Divisional Coronavirus Service and Prevention Task Force and
Principal of Rangpur Medical College Professor Dr. AKM Nurunnobi Lyzu said
the vaccination campaign continues smoothly at government hospitals in the
division.

“Common people should abide by the health directives to check the spread of
COVID-19 as the infection rate is showing a rising trend again in the
division during the last two weeks,” Dr Lyzu added.
